Glastonbury the great

The original and the greatest, Glastonbury is the festival to end all festivals, but boy when it’s wet, it’s wet. Despite an explosion of similarly hippy-inspired events in recent years, Glasto retains a soft spot in music aficionados’ hearts, and its unique ‘anything goes’ vibe, whether its dancing to Kylie on the Pyramid stage or lying semi-naked in the Green Fields while bongs thrum.

When planning for Glastonbury, wellies should be the first consideration – then build upwards from your toes. The weekend, especially if it rains, does require camping-savvy garb but make sure you inject plenty of fun for all the dress-up opportunities; a prom dress is a must for impromptu tea dances in the field, as is fun fur for a dose of glamour (or just plain silliness).

We say pack a glamorous waterproof to keep dry till you’re back in your tent – and then hope that the sun shines anyway!
